博达路由器备份与恢复:确保配置安全无忧,维护网络稳定
发布时间: 2025-01-06 15:29:24 阅读量: 6 订阅数: 6
博达路由器配置文件备份和恢复的方法.pdf
![博达路由器配置经典教程.doc](https://i0.hdslb.com/bfs/archive/dda3d04bc7dd6c3c8ec0af219ed61e064f50d08b.png)
# 摘要
博达路由器的备份与恢复是网络设备管理的重要组成部分,关系到网络服务的稳定性和数据安全性。本文从博达路由器备份与恢复的基本概念入手,详细探讨了配置备份的理论与实践操作,包括备份的重要性、备份方法、备份验证及恢复过程。接着,文章深入分析了数据恢复的策略与性能优化,提出了有效的脚本化备份和恢复流程,以及高级应用方案,如多路由器环境下的备份策略和灾难恢复规划。最后,通过案例分析,本文总结了备份与恢复的常见错误和成功经验,旨在为网络工程师提供实用的技术指导和操作建议。
# 关键字
博达路由器;备份与恢复;配置备份;性能优化;自动化脚本;灾难恢复规划;案例分析
参考资源链接:[博达路由器全面配置教程:基础设置与命令详解](https://wenku.csdn.net/doc/5c1vpccna8?spm=1055.2635.3001.10343)
# 1. 博达路由器备份与恢复概述
在当今快节奏的网络环境中,博达路由器的备份与恢复是一项关键的维护任务。有效的备份策略不仅可以在设备出现故障时保证业务的连续性,而且可以在网络配置发生变更时,提供必要的版本控制和回滚机制。理解备份和恢复的概念,对于任何负责网络基础设施的IT专业人员来说,都是不可或缺的。
接下来的章节将详细探讨博达路由器备份与恢复的各个方面,包括备份的理论基础、实践方法,以及恢复的策略和优化。我们将从备份的重要性出发,逐步深入到配置备份的具体方法,然后过渡到如何验证备份的完整性以及如何有效地进行恢复操作。最后,我们还会探讨如何通过自动化备份与恢复流程来提高运维效率,并分析在不同场景下高级应用的实现策略。
# 2. 博达路由器配置备份理论与实践
### 2.1 路由器备份的重要性
#### 2.1.1 理解配置备份的目的
在现代网络环境中,路由器是连接不同网络的重要桥梁,它承载着大量网络流量的转发任务,以及网络策略的实施。博达路由器作为企业级网络设备中的常见选择,其配置的安全性和稳定性对于整个网络的可靠运行至关重要。配置备份的目的主要包括:
- **灾难恢复**:在设备发生故障或配置错误导致服务中断时,可以通过备份文件迅速恢复到之前的状态,最小化停机时间。
- **配置审计**:备份文件可以作为历史记录,用于审计和配置变更的追踪,有助于管理网络变更并确保遵循最佳实践。
- **网络迁移**:在进行网络升级或迁移时,可以将配置迁移到新的或更新的设备上,确保网络配置的一致性。
- **知识传递**:备份文件可以作为知识共享的工具,帮助其他网络管理员快速理解和掌握设备的配置状态。
#### 2.1.2 常见备份场景分析
备份配置的场景多种多样,下面列举了几个常见的备份场景:
- **定期备份**:为了应对配置变更可能带来的风险,定期自动备份路由器配置是保障网络安全的常规操作。
- **更新或升级前备份**:在对路由器进行软件更新或硬件升级之前,备份当前的配置是明智之举,以防升级失败导致配置丢失。
- **重大变更前备份**:对网络进行重大变更或更改关键配置时,预先进行备份可以防止意外情况导致的配置丢失。
- **灾难恢复计划的一部分**:在制定灾难恢复计划时,配置备份是其中关键的一环,确保能够在灾难发生后迅速恢复正常运营。
### 2.2 路由器配置备份的方法
#### 2.2.1 TFTP/FTP服务器备份
通过TFTP/FTP服务器备份配置是一种广泛采用的方法,因为这种方式可以轻松地跨平台操作,并且可以通过网络远程完成。
##### 配置步骤详解:
1. **确保TFTP/FTP服务器可用性**:在备份开始之前,确保TFTP/FTP服务器已正确配置并且可以接受文件上传。
2. **配置博达路由器**:在路由器上配置TFTP/FTP服务器的IP地址、用户名、密码等参数。
3. **执行备份命令**:使用路由器上的命令行接口(CLI)发起备份命令,并指定备份文件名。
示例命令:
```shell
BDCOM> enable
Password: ******
BDCOM# copy running-config tftp://[tftp-server-ip]/[backup-filename.cfg]
```
- **参数解释**:
- `[tftp-server-ip]`:TFTP服务器的IP地址。
- `[backup-filename.cfg]`:希望保存的备份文件名。
- **代码逻辑分析**:
- 首先通过`enable`命令进入特权模式。
- 输入正确的密码进行认证。
- 使用`copy`命令将当前的运行配置复制到TFTP服务器上的指定路径。
#### 2.2.2 本地存储备份
在某些情况下,可能无法通过网络连接到外部服务器进行备份,这时候本地存储设备就成为了备份配置的一个重要途径。
##### 配置步骤详解:
1. **准备存储介质**:确保路由器支持连接的存储介质,如USB闪存盘或SD卡。
2. **连接存储设备**:将存储介质连接到路由器的指定端口。
3. **执行本地备份命令**:通过CLI命令将配置文件复制到本地存储设备中。
示例命令:
```shell
BDCOM> enable
Password: ******
BDCOM# copy running-config disk0:/[backup-filename.cfg]
```
- **参数解释**:
- `disk0:/`:本地存储设备的路径,此处假设为磁盘0。
- `[backup-filename.cfg]`:备份文件名。
- **代码逻辑分析**:
- 类似于TFTP/FTP备份,首先通过`enable`进入特权模式。
- 然后通过`copy`命令将当前的运行配置复制到本地存储设备指定路径。
#### 2.2.3 使用命令行进行备份
除了TFTP/FTP服务器备份和本地存储备份之外,博达路由器还支持通过命令行直接进行配置的备份操作。
##### 配置步骤详解:
1. **登录到路由器**:使用CLI工具登录到博达路由器。
2. **进入特权模式**:输入`enable`命令并提供密码以进入特权模式。
3. **执行保存命令**:使用特定命令保存配置到指定位置。
示例命令:
```shell
BDCOM> enable
Password: ******
BDCOM# save
```
- **参数解释**:
- `save`:执行保存命令,路由器会提示输入文件名和保存位置。
- **代码逻辑分析**:
- 命令`save`是用于保存当前配置到闪存的内置命令。
- 通常不涉及直接指定外部存储介质,因为这通常与`copy`命令结合使用来实现。
### 2.3 路由器配置备份的验证与恢复
#### 2.3.1 备份文件的校验方法
备份文件的完整性是备份成功的关键,因此需要验证备份文件的正确性,以确保在需要恢复配置时能够正常工作。
##### 验证步骤:
1. **下载备份文件**:如果备份到远程服务器,确保可以从服务器上下载该文件。
2. **文件完整性检查**:检查文件的大小、MD5或SHA校验和,确保文件没有在传输过程中损坏。
3. **备份内容审查**:使用文本编辑器打开备份文件,检查文件内容是否符合预期的配置格式。
##### 代码块示例:
```shell
# 计算文件的MD5校验和
md5sum [backup-filename.cfg]
```
- **参数解释**:
- `[backup-filename.cfg]`:需要验证的备份文件名。
- **代码逻辑分析**:
- 使用`md5sum`命令计算文件的MD5校验值,与备份之前记录的校验值进行对比。
- 如果校验值匹配,则文件未损坏;如果不匹配,则表示文件可能在备份过程中或之后损坏,需要重新备份。
#### 2.3.2 恢复过程的详细步骤
在路由器遇到配置问题或需要恢复到之前的设置时,可以使用备份文件恢复配置。
##### 恢复步骤:
1. **登录到路由器**:通过CLI或远程管理工具登录到博达路由器。
2. **加载备份文件**:将备份文件传输到路由器或加载到其可用的存储介质中。
3. **执行恢复命令**:使用恢复命令将备份配置加载到路由器上。
示例命令:
```shell
BDCOM> enable
Password: ******
BDCOM# copy tftp://[tftp-server-ip]/[backup-filename.cfg] running-config
```
- **参数解释**:
- `tftp://[tftp-server-ip]/[b
0
0